About The Position

The People and Culture manager supports the administration and delivery of key People & Culture programs and contribute to a positive and supportive Colleague experience. This role is responsible for overseeing core colleague support programs including benefits administration, leave of absence management, workers compensation and the annual open enrollment process, ensuring programs are administered accurately and in compliance with company policies and applicable regulations Benefits Manager is responsible for the administration and oversight of the hotel’s colleague benefits programs. This role ensures effective management of benefits including health insurance, dental and vision plans, employee assistance programs, retirement plans, and wellness initiatives.

Responsibilities

  • Oversee the administration of colleague benefits programs including medical, dental, vision, employee assistance program (EAP), and other wellness benefits.
  • Serve as the primary point of contact for colleagues regarding benefits eligibility, enrollment, and program questions.
  • Coordinate with benefits providers and third-party administrators to ensure accurate and timely processing of benefits.
  • Responsible for monitoring and administration, report generation, and communication with employees, managers, insurance carriers and medical staff in regarding to Family Medical Leave Act and Hawaii Family Leave Act.
  • Maintain and Champion the Dayforce Program when administering all benefit programs
  • Coordinate all benefit correspondence in regard to the interactive process or any and all medical letters between the doctors, employee and hotel.
  • Maintain accurate leave records and ensure appropriate communication with leadership regarding employee status and return-to-work timelines.
  • Oversee the administration of workers’ compensation claims, including reporting incidents, coordinating with insurance carriers, and supporting colleagues through the claims process.
  • Partner with the Risk & Safety team to ensure timely reporting and follow-up of workplace injuries.
  • Responsible for claims monitoring and administration, report generation, and communication with employees, managers, insurance carriers and medical staff.
  • Maintain and Champion the FROL Program when reporting all worker’s comp claims.
  • Ensure all safety action plans are followed up with the injured worker and employee.
